Python1000实践进阶:UML图设计与用例实现指南

需积分: 9 0 下载量 105 浏览量 更新于2024-11-14 收藏 483KB ZIP 举报
资源摘要信息:"Python1000-Practice-Activities:UML设计的行业标准活动和用例叙述,供有经验的初学者或已完成“ Python 1000”培训的学生使用" Python是一种广泛使用的高级编程语言,以其可读性强、语法简洁和灵活性高著称。对于有志于从事编程工作的初学者和中级学生,实践是提高编程能力的重要环节。Python1000实践活动是为那些已经完成基础Python培训或具备一定编程经验的学生设计的。 该实践活动包含了一系列面向中级Python学习者的练习,旨在帮助他们巩固所学知识并提升实践能力。这些活动是“Python 1000”培训系列的后续,涵盖了从基础语法到项目开发的各个方面。参与这些活动可以加深对Python编程的理解,同时也帮助学习者了解在真实世界中的项目是如何被设计和实现的。 UML(统一建模语言)是一种用于软件工程的标准方式,用于可视化、设计、构建和文档化软件系统的不同方面。UML包含多种图表类型,如用例图、类图、活动图、序列图等,每种图表都描述了系统的不同视图或不同方面的设计。 在本项目中,学习者将被引导通过行业标准的UML设计来创建软件。这包括从专业定义的用例出发,设计系统架构、编写代码和测试软件。对于那些参加过其他Python培训机会的学习者,如Pythoneers(Python的爱好者或开发者),这些活动也是极佳的补充材料。 该资源还提到了提供职业建议和3种额外的奖励,这些奖励可能包括额外的学习材料、工具或技巧,以帮助学生进一步提升技能并更好地准备进入职场。 使用标签“python training students uml software training-materials requirement-specifications Python”,表明了该资源的多个核心点。它强调了Python的学习、UML在软件设计中的应用、培训材料的提供以及需求规格的编写。所有这些元素共同构成了软件开发人员必备的技能。 该资源的文件名称为“Python1000-Practice-Activities-master”,暗示这是一套完整的实践活动,可能包含多个子模块或章节,每个都对应不同的练习或案例研究。学习者可以从这些活动中挑选适合自己的项目,进行实践和学习。 总结来说,Python1000实践活动旨在通过一系列针对中级学习者的软件设计和开发练习,帮助他们掌握使用UML进行软件设计的技能。这些活动不仅能够加深学习者对Python编程的理解,还能够让他们在实际的软件开发项目中更有效地应用所学知识。通过结合UML设计和用例叙述,学习者能够更好地理解软件开发的全貌,为将来的职业发展打下坚实的基础。